Glad to hear some good news on central, i'm up to my ears in all the bad stuff. I see that there is a red pete 387, is that a lease truck? If so what trucks are they offering for their lease and what are the payments like? Just askin as much info now before i give them the yes.

I am not a lease op, so you will have to wait for them for actual payment numbers.
They offer a 2 year on the volvo 670's new.
They have T2000s and W900s used that the payments are lower on. You can get leases from 12 months or more on them.
Also new W900s.

In my eyes the payments are very high, I dont think any but the volvo 670 is less than 400 a week. Over mileage kicks in at 2800 miles. Starts at like .05 and by 3200 goes up to .15 cpm.

Driver pay is only .85 cpm, but if you can get good fuel economy you can make some money on the surcharge. It is based on the national average and changes every week. It is on loaded miles only though, unless you are on the coors fleet, they get it for all dispatched miles, including deadhead.
